The variant allocator served the discounted-fare arm to 31% of sessions instead of the configured 20%, beginning at the last config push. No evidence of tampering has been found, but the override path bypasses the usual signed-config check, which warrants security review. Pricing exposure is capped by the experiment's fare floor, so revenue risk is bounded. Please audit the config pipeline permissions before we re-enable the experiment. Questions or findings should be routed to the experimentation platform team.

alerts address for kajog-tadup: druox@plorvanet.internal

### Laundry Locker Access Flow (Fragment 4)

When a resident reports a stuck locker on a Tumblevale kiosk, first confirm the reservation is still active in the Spindry console. If active, issue a remote unlock via the Lockmaven bridge — never the kiosk debug menu, as that voids the audit trail. The bridge call requires the support-tier credential scoped to `locker.unlock` only; do not reuse the provisioning credential. All unlocks are logged with the agent handle. Authenticate the bridge call using the key below.

API key for kahop-bagef: zpat2_yb

**Handover Note – Site Capacity, Orlan Fabrication**

To the incoming director: the Drelmouth plant is running at roughly 85% capacity, and the board expects a decision on the second extrusion line by end of quarter. Maintenance backlog figures are in the shared planning folder; staffing projections were updated last week by Petra Vance. A supplier review with Kellan Works is pending. Context for the decision is summarised below.

internal memo for taguf-kafop: Novmirax Group plans to lower the Oliius list price by 42.0 percent in March. The board signed off on a budget of $367.8 million for Project Belael. The renewal with Drumirax Logistics closes at $302.4 million a year, 54.0 percent below the last contract. Project Kelys slips by a full year because of the staffing delay.